What Lady Mariko Taught Us About The Hero's Journey

1 min read

Lady Mariko’s journey is not one of swords alone—it is a path carved through choices that defy expectation. In a world where duty binds and honor demands silence, she dared to listen to her own voice, reshaping what it means to be a hero.

What did Lady Mariko teach about the hero’s journey?

Lady Mariko showed that the truest journeys begin not with a call to adventure, but with a question of identity. Her path was not paved by destiny but by deliberate choices that challenged the roles she was born into.

What is Lady Mariko’s most important lesson?

Her greatest lesson is that heroism often lies in defiance, not obedience. She proved that loyalty can be a trap when it silences the soul, and that true strength comes from aligning with one’s truth—even when it costs everything.

How did her choices redefine the hero’s path?

While many heroes rise through battle, Lady Mariko rose through transformation. She moved from a pawn in political marriage to a leader who shaped her own fate, proving that the heart of the journey is inner awakening, not outer conquest.

What role did love play in her version of the hero’s journey?

Love, for Lady Mariko, was not a distraction but a compass. Her bond with Kenshin taught her that connection can be a source of clarity, not weakness—a lesson that helped her see beyond vengeance and into purpose.

Why does her journey resonate today?

Because it mirrors our own. We, too, are bound by expectations and inherited roles. Lady Mariko teaches us that the hero’s call is not always loud—it can be a quiet voice within, urging us toward becoming who we are meant to be.
